Please note:
Under the CRD, you have 14 calendar days to change your mind without having to give a reason. This right to cancel is also known as the ‘cooling-off period’.
Your right to cancel begins from the moment you place the order. However, your ‘cooling-off period’ will depend on the type of purchase you made, as follows:
Products (goods): Starts the moment you receive the product. You have 14 days to tell the trader you want to cancel and then a further 14 days to return the products. You may have to pay for the cost of returning the products.

Consumer Protection
If you have purchased our products online, you will be covered by the statutory Consumer Contracts Regulations.
Provided no seals have been broken and the product has not been used/eaten (ie: it must be in ‘new’ condition), Consumer Contracts Regulations give you the right to cancel an order placed with us via phone or online within 14 days of receiving your items. This can be for any reason provided the item is complete and undamaged. You then have 14 days from the date you notify us of your wish to cancel the order in which to return the product(s).We will process your refund within 14 days of having received the returned good(s) or proof of having returned the goods (for example, a proof of postage receipt from the post office), whichever is the sooner. You will be refunded for the full cost of the product(s) as well as any original shipping fees paid. If you are returning part of a larger order, you may only be refunded a portion of any shipping fees paid. Consumer Contracts Regulations do not apply to perishable items (eg: fresh royal jelly and fresh bee pollen) or goods with a seal for health protection and hygiene reasons that’s been broken.
If the item(s) you receive is somehow faulty or otherwise not as described, your right to return your item(s) is covered under the The Consumer Protection Act 2007.
Consumer Rights Directive is referred to as S.I. No. 484/2013 – European Union (Consumer Information, Cancellation and Other Rights) Regulations 2013 or for short ‘the regulations’.
